CAUTION:
Nitrous oxide cartridges should not be used as pressure sources for high
temperature, high pressure (HTHP) filtration. Under temperature and pressure, nitrous oxide can detonate in the presence of grease, oil, or carbonaceous materials. Nitrous oxide cartridges are to be used only for Garrett Gas Train Carbonate Analysis. Carbon dioxide and nitrous oxide cartridges are pressurized to approximately 900 psi at 1 atmosphere (sea level). Therefore, they should never be placed on airplanes without proper packaging due to the possibility of cabin depressurizing, which may result in an explosion.
